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H 02/23] target-sparc: Make CPU_LOG_INT useful by default
Date: Fri, 5 Oct 2012 16:54:49 -0700

No need for ifdefs when the log mask does just as well.
No need to print pc/npc when we're dumping the whole cpu state.

Signed-off-by: Richard Henderson <address@hidden>
---
 target-sparc/int32_helper.c | 7 ++-----
 target-sparc/int64_helper.c | 8 ++------
 2 files changed, 4 insertions(+), 11 deletions(-)

diff --git a/target-sparc/int32_helper.c b/target-sparc/int32_helper.c
index 5e33d50..9ac5aac 100644
--- a/target-sparc/int32_helper.c
+++ b/target-sparc/int32_helper.c
@@ -21,7 +21,7 @@
 #include "trace.h"
 #include "sysemu.h"
 
-//#define DEBUG_PCALL
+#define DEBUG_PCALL
 
 #ifdef DEBUG_PCALL
 static const char * const excp_names[0x80] = {
@@ -78,10 +78,7 @@ void do_interrupt(CPUSPARCState *env)
             }
         }
 
-        qemu_log("%6d: %s (v=%02x) pc=%08x npc=%08x SP=%08x\n",
-                count, name, intno,
-                env->pc,
-                env->npc, env->regwptr[6]);
+        qemu_log("%6d: %s (v=%02x)\n", count, name, intno);
         log_cpu_state(env, 0);
 #if 0
         {
diff --git a/target-sparc/int64_helper.c b/target-sparc/int64_helper.c
index 5e3eff7..5d0bc6c 100644
--- a/target-sparc/int64_helper.c
+++ b/target-sparc/int64_helper.c
@@ -21,7 +21,7 @@
 #include "helper.h"
 #include "trace.h"
 
-//#define DEBUG_PCALL
+#define DEBUG_PCALL
 
 #ifdef DEBUG_PCALL
 static const char * const excp_names[0x80] = {
@@ -84,11 +84,7 @@ void do_interrupt(CPUSPARCState *env)
             }
         }
 
-        qemu_log("%6d: %s (v=%04x) pc=%016" PRIx64 " npc=%016" PRIx64
-                " SP=%016" PRIx64 "\n",
-                count, name, intno,
-                env->pc,
-                env->npc, env->regwptr[6]);
+        qemu_log("%6d: %s (v=%04x)\n", count, name, intno);
         log_cpu_state(env, 0);
 #if 0
         {
